As a headhunter and career coach, I’ve seen it: work that lights people up from the inside. Work where they’re expressed, engaged, fully alive. That’s what I want for you – and for myself.

Finding work that matters takes effort at any age. You’re figuring out what you want to do, what you actually enjoy doing. Call it your choice career. Your chosen profession. Your vocation. Your work.

Why do we work? To make a living, yes. But also to contribute something because we know we have knowledge, skills, and expertise that matter to others.

You might be a doorman. You’re the first smile someone sees entering their building after a brutal day. You’re safety. You’re welcome.

You might pump gas. You’re helping a frazzled parent get back on the road to pick up their child. You see them. You help them keep moving.

You might wait tables, clean homes, drive a taxi, teach yoga, paint houses, wash cars.

As Kahlil Gibran wrote, “Work is love made visible.”

The value? You’re in the stream of human life. You’re touching people’s days, solving their problems, making things work, creating order from chaos, helping them breathe, move, arrive, feel seen. Every interaction carries weight. Every task completed allows someone else’s life to flow and be better off.

Even before you land your dream role – even now, in whatever work you’re doing – you can practice mattering.

  • Show up on time.
  • Be reliable.
  • Offer genuine, kind, empowering service.
  • Find better ways.
  • Help the people beside you.

These aren’t just actions; they’re who you’re becoming.

Ask yourself:

In your present work, what matters to you?

Where could you care more, give more, create ripples of good around you?

The work that fulfills you is often closer than you think. Sometimes it’s not about finding a completely different job – it’s about finding a different way to show up in the job you have.

That’s where transformation happens for you and others.
